Transaction 3431df39d5e0af14531d9fb9e5763d086a29f9d67da674faf1b3d8552a80cbae

1 Input
2 Outputs
  • 3431df39d5e0af14531d9fb9e5763d086a29f9d67da674faf1b3d8552a80cbae:0
  • value  15605753
    address  32NbuBanjGPgna83CX4DQigzSrQn87VxFF
  • 3431df39d5e0af14531d9fb9e5763d086a29f9d67da674faf1b3d8552a80cbae:1
  • value  22415292
    address  1FKvXPEwEaXEJMiyDYW95rot9twthJ7TwS